Issue/Introduction

No support protocol found when trying to open the Real-Time functionality on the Resource Manager of a PC.

PPA debug logs show the error: Unable to invoke requested method on given webservice. Error- Failed to verify signature on xml blob

Cause

Mismatch of Credential Manager Public Keys between the SMP Server and Symantec_CMDB database.

Resolution

Step 1: Check if the Symantec management agent is properly installed and can connect with the server without any issues. Do a send inventory and check logs for any communication error. Check if the Symantec Management agent is communicating with the server using HTTPS or HTTP.

Step 2: Check if Credential Manager WCF services are working properly  -

         ~Type the following URLs into the web browser if NS and Altiris Agent are set to communicate in non-SSL mode :
http://localhost/Altiris/CredentialManager/Service/CredentialManagerRegisterWebService.svc

http://localhost/Altiris/CredentialManager/Service/CredentialManagerServicesWebService.svc

      ~Type the following URLs into web browser if NS and Altiris Agent is set to communicate in ssl mode :
https://localhost/Altiris/CredentialManager/Service/CredentialManagerRegisterWebServiceSecure.svc

https://localhost/Altiris/CredentialManager/Service/CredentialManagerServicesWebServiceSecure.svc

               On typing the URL on the browser you must see a page saying “This is a Windows© Communication Foundation service.

 Step 3 : If  Symantec Management agent is working properly along with WCF services perform the below mentioned steps -
~Perform a full backup of the SMP Server and Symantec_CMDB database.
~Remove all rows from CMClientPublicKey.
~Delete registry key HKLM\Software\Altiris\CredentialManager
~Uninstall existing Symantec management agent and re-install it.
(OPTIONAL)
~After installation wait for Altiris agent to get “computer Id”. [ Check it in Symantec Management Agent > Settings dialog ]. (OPTIONAL)
~Once you see “computer id” being present re-run CMClientInstall.exe from NSCap\Bin\x64\CredentialManager as Administrator. Check whether ServerURL,Exchange, Signature values are created under registry hive HKLM\Software\Altiris\CredentialManager\Keys\{GUID.EN_US}.
~Do a reboot of the SMP Server.
~Re-launch the browser and Symantec management console to check whether existing and new Connection profiles and credentials are working.
